Transaction dbbb9be69591be40863a136c5f87f1c2fc9948930256ee2b21b33a75668ec87c

23 Input
2 Outputs
  • dbbb9be69591be40863a136c5f87f1c2fc9948930256ee2b21b33a75668ec87c:0
  • value  822901
    address  bc1qmuhv0yqjln3cjkevap3dptw2cv7a75w966px0h
  • dbbb9be69591be40863a136c5f87f1c2fc9948930256ee2b21b33a75668ec87c:1
  • value  17582140
    address  3MNvECcu6DfGDBmrFMzvu9SWUC1N9trEmr